Z-Post 4 Rope System & MGT

Depending on project requirements the NCHRP 350 TL-4 Z-Post length of need (LON) barrier can be terminated using the Brifen MASH Gating Terminal (MGT). With the MASH test rating and simplified, in-line design the MGT has a no-release cable feature and fewer parts. Consider using the MGT as a terminal upgrade when removing/resetting anchors on existing Brifen Z-Post installations or in new Z-Post installations to anticipate barrier section (LON) upgrades to MASH in the future.

Why Brifen systems?

  • Patented interwoven cables

    • Creates high rope/post friction and causes each post to act as a “mini-anchor”

    • Better performance on curves

    • Eliminates need for intermediate anchors

    • Deflections are more predictable

    • Limits extent of damage

  • Does not impede drainage and reduces wind row from snow or sand

  • Cost-effective compared to other longitudinal barriers

  • Rarely results in serious injury to vehicle occupants

  • No metal attachments that may create hazardous debris upon impact

  • No field swaging or hardware assembly required to connect ropes

  • Non-releasing terminal connection reduces likelihood of losing system tension

Z-Post Wire Rope Safety Fence (WRSF)

NCHRP 350 TL-4

The Z-Post system is a high-tension median or roadside cable barrier system successfully tested to TL-4 and TL-3 on flat grade and to TL-3 on a 4:1 slope per FHWA Eligibility Letters HSA-10/B-82B, B82-B1 and B-82D. The Length of Need (LON) consists of Galvanized Steel Z-Posts, also called Line Posts, which are placed in socketed concrete foundations or driven steel sockets.

The top rope rests in a slot in the top of the post and the three bottom ropes alternate post sides, while resting on plastic pegs. Line posts also have a plastic excluder and post cap with a reflector attached at required intervals per agency requirements. The woven rope design improves system performance and ease of maintenance while providing predictable deflections regardless of length between terminals.

MASH Gating Terminal (MGT)

MASH TL-3

Brifen’s MASH Gating Terminal (MGT) has been successfully tested to MASH 2016 with FHWA Eligibility Letter HSST1/CC137. It can be located anywhere within the clear zone and has all ropes anchored into one foundation. The inline level design is 37LF and includes three terminal posts.

Site specific soil analysis by a Professional Engineer is imperative for proper foundation sizing to prevent anchor movement and provide adequate factor of safety when rope tension increases at lower temperatures.
